STEP 5. Check the evaporative emission ventilation
solenoid using scan tool MB991958 (Actuator test item 29).
CAUTION
To prevent damage to scan tool MB991958, always turn the
ignition switch to the "LOCK" (OFF) position before con-
necting or disconnecting scan tool MB991958.
(1) Connect scan tool MB991958 to the data link connector.
(2) Disconnect the hose E from the evaporative emission
ventilation solenoid side.
(3) Connect the hand vacuum pump to the nipple of the
evaporative emission ventilation solenoid from which the
hoses have been disconnected.
(4) Turn the ignition switch to the "ON" position.
(5) Set scan tool MB991958 to actuator test mode for item 29:
Evaporative Emission Ventilation Solenoid. When the
evaporative emission ventilation solenoid is operated, apply
a pressure on the hand vacuum pump and confirm that air
is maintained.
(6) Turn the ignition switch to the "LOCK" (OFF) position, and
disconnect scan tool MB991958.
(7) Disconnect the hand vacuum pump, and connect hose E to
the evaporative emission canister.
Q: Is the evaporative emission ventilation solenoid in good
condition?
YES : Go to Step 6.
NO : Replace the evaporative emission ventilation
solenoid. Then go to Step 18.

STEP 6. Pressure test for evaporator line from hose D to
hose N.
(1) Remove the module bracket mounting bolts, and
disconnect hose E from the evaporative emission
ventilation solenoid side, and plug the hoses from which the
hoses have been disconnected.
(2) Confirm that the evaporative emission system pressure
pump (Miller number 6872A) is operating properly. Perform
the self-test as described in the manufacturer's instructions.
(3) Connect an evaporative emission system pressure pump to
the fuel filler neck.
(4) Pressure test the system to determine whether any leaks
are present.
NOTE: "Pressure test" in this procedure refers to the
I/M240 Simulation Test (8 simple steps) described in the
evaporative emission system pressure pump (Miller number
6872A) manufacturer's instructions located in the lid of the
pump box.
Q: Are the evaporator line in good condition?
YES : Go to Step 17.
NO : Go to Step 7.
STEP 7. Pressure test for evaporator line from hose G to
hose N.
(1) Disconnect hose G from the evaporative emission canister
side, and plug the hose from which the pipes have been
disconnected.
(2) Perform the pressure test again.
Q: Are the evaporator line in good condition?
YES : Go to Step 8.
NO : Go to Step 10.

STEP 8. Check for leaks in the evaporator line hose D to
hose F.
(1) Remove the fuel tank. (Refer to GROUP 13C, Fuel Tank
(2) The leakage test with a hand vacuum pump on each hose
from hose D to hose F.
Q: Are the hoses in good condition?
YES : Go to Step 9.
NO : Replace that hose, reinstall the fuel tank. (Refer to
GROUP 13C, Fuel Tank
.) Then go to Step
18.
STEP 9. Check for leaks in the evaporative emission
canister.
(1) Connect a hand vacuum pump to the vent nipple of the
evaporative emission canister.
(2) Plug the other two nipples or loop a hose between the other
nipples.
(3) Apply a vacuum with the hand vacuum pump, and confirm
that the applied vacuum does not fluctuate.
Q: Is the evaporation emission canister in good condition?
YES : Go to Step 18.
NO : Replace the evaporative emission canister (Refer to
GROUP 17, Evaporative Emission Canister and Fuel
Tank Pressure Relief Valve
.) and reinstall
the fuel tank. (Refer to GROUP 13C, Fuel Tank
.) Then go to Step 18.

STEP 10. Check for leaks in the evaporator line from hose
H and hose I.
(1) Remove the fuel filler neck protector. (Refer to GROUP
13C, Fuel Tank
(2) Disconnect hose H at the liquid separator, and then connect
a hand vacuum pump to the hose.
(3) Disconnect hose I at the fuel tank side, and then plug the
hose.
(4) Apply vacuum with the hand vacuum pump, and confirm
that the applied vacuum does not fluctuate.
Q: Are the evaporator line in good condition?
YES : Go to Step 11.
NO : Replace that hose, reinstall the fuel filler neck
protector. (Refer to GROUP 13C, Fuel Tank
.) Then go to Step 18.
STEP11. Check for leaks in the evaporator line hose G, J,
K, L and M.
(1) Remove the fuel tank and fuel filler neck assembly. (Refer
to GROUP 13C, Fuel Tank
.)
(2) The leakage test with a hand vacuum pump on each hose
from hose G, J, K, L and M.
Q: Are the hoses in good condition?
YES : Go to Step 12.
NO : Replace the hose, reinstall the fuel tank and fuel filler
neck assembly. (Refer to GROUP 13C, Fuel Tank
.) Then go to Step 18.
